Blue turmeric, scientifically known as Curcuma caesia, is a rare rhizome native to India and Southeast Asia. Distinguished by its dark blue interior, it possesses a unique camphor-like aroma and earthy flavour. Traditionally used in Ayurvedic medicine for its anti-inflammatory and analgesic properties, blue turmeric is also valued in culinary applications and natural dyes. Its striking colour and potent compounds make it a notable variant among turmeric species.
